Text and Translation

As quoted from Makarim al-Akhlaq: when you go to sleep at night, put close to the side of your head a clean vessel full of pure water, covered by a clean piece of cloth. When you wake up to offer the Night Prayer, drink three doses of that water and perform the ritual ablution (wudu') with the rest of it. Then turn your face towards the qiblah direction, recite the adhan and iqamah statements, and offer a two-unit prayer, reciting whatever Surah you would like. While genuflecting, repeat the following supplicatory statement twenty-five times:

يَا غِيَاثَ الْمُسْتَغِيْثِيْنَ

YAA GHIYAATHAL MUSTAGHEETHEEN

O Aid of those who pray for aid,

When you stand erect again after the genuflection (ruku'), repeat the same statement twenty-five times. In the two prostrations of the prayer and the position of sitting between them, repeat the same statement twenty-five times each. When you stand up for the second unit, do the same as in the first. By this, you have repeated this statement three hundred times. Finish your prayer after uttering the statements of tashahhud and taslim. Keeping yourself in the sitting position of the prayer, raise your head towards the sky and repeat the following statement thirty times:

مِنَ الْعَبْدِ الذَّلِيْلِ اِلَى الْمَوْلَى الْجَلِيْلِ

MINAL A'BDIZ ZALEELI ILAL MAWLAL JALEEL

From the abject servant to the Glorious Master.

You may then submit your request, and the response will come very shortly, by the permission of Almighty Allah.
